Welcome to the TileScout prefetcher review! TileScout guesses which map tiles a user will pan to next and warms the cache ahead of time. Prediction requests go through our internal Wayfinder gateway, so nothing hits the public tile servers directly. The worker authenticates to Wayfinder on boot. Add the following line to your local env file:

secret setting of yajog-taguf: ARCHIVE_KEY3=051

v3.9.2 — Fixed flaky DNS resolution in the Hollowpine gateway. Resolver now retries with a 250ms backoff and pins healthy upstreams for five minutes. On-call: watch for stale pins after upstream failover; manual flush command is in the runbook. Alerts below warning level can be ignored for 48 hours. Questions go to the owner below.

named custodian: Fraion Holael

## Heads up: the DNS gremlin

Every few weeks, lookups through the Brambleway resolver get flaky — timeouts, then fine, then timeouts again. Usually it's the stale-cache node in the Ostmere cluster. Restarting it fixes ~90% of cases; the fix-it script is in the oncall repo. If it keeps flapping after a restart, just email the network crew.

billing contact of hahig-yajop = fraael_fraox@nelvrocorp.internal